All That Breathes

Amid civil unrest and environmental degradation in populous, polluted New Delhi, where two brothers devote their lives to protecting the endangered black kite, a majestic bird of prey essential to the city’s ecosystem.

UK/India/USA, 2022, Shaunak Sen

The first movie to win the Best Documentary prize at both Sundance and Cannes, this much-praised new film is  “A subtle, haunting reflection on the meaning of humanity.” –NY Times. “Maybe the most beautifully realized documentary in recent memory.” –L.A. Times. Cleveland premiere. Subtitles. DCP. 94 min. www.allthatbreathes.com
